다음을 통해 공유


CWnd::OnAppCommand

프레임 워크는 사용자가 응용 프로그램 명령 이벤트를 생성할 때이 멤버 함수를 호출 합니다. 이러한 이벤트는 응용 프로그램 명령 단추나 형식 응용 프로그램 명령 키를 클릭할 때 발생 합니다.

afx_msg void OnAppCommand(
    CWnd* pWnd,
    UINT nCmd,
    UINT nDevice,
    UINT nKey
);

매개 변수

Parameter

설명

[in] pWnd

포인터는 CWnd 사용자가 명령 단추를 클릭 하거나 명령 키를 누르고 위치 창을 나타내는 개체입니다. 이 창 메시지를 받는 창의 자식 창이 될 수 있습니다.

[in] nCmd

응용 프로그램 명령을 나타냅니다. 명령에서 사용할 수 있는 값 목록을 볼의 cmd 섹션의 lParam 매개 변수를 WM_APPCOMMAND.

[in] nDevice

입력된 이벤트를 생성 하는 입력된 장치입니다. 장치에서 사용 가능한 값 목록을 보려면을 참조 하십시오의 uDevice 섹션의 lParam 매개 변수를 WM_APPCOMMAND.

[in] nKey

아래로 CTRL 키 또는 마우스 왼쪽된 단추와 같은 모든 가상 키를 나타냅니다. 키에서 사용 가능한 값 목록을 보려면을 참조 하십시오의 dwKeys 섹션의 lParam 매개 변수를 WM_APPCOMMAND. 자세한 내용은 "메시지 매개 변수" 소 제목에 마우스 입력에 대 한.

설명

이 메서드에 전달 된 WM_APPCOMMAND 에서 설명 하는 알림은 Windows SDK.

참고

이 멤버 함수는 Windows 메시지를 처리 하는 응용 프로그램을 허용 하는 프레임 워크에서 호출 됩니다.메시지를 받을 때 프레임 워크에 의해 전달 된 매개 변수를 함수에 전달 된 매개 변수를 반영 합니다.이 함수의 기본 클래스 구현을 호출 하는 경우 해당 구현을 원래 메시지와 입력 매개 변수가 없는 함수에 전달 된 매개 변수를 사용 합니다.

요구 사항

헤더: afxwin.h

이 메서드가 지원 Windows Vista 이상.

이 메서드에 대 한 추가 요구 사항에서 설명 Windows Vista 공용 컨트롤의 빌드 요구 사항.

참고 항목

참조

CWnd 클래스

계층 구조 차트

WM_APPCOMMAND